A rival manager in the Premier League has made a big a claim about Manchester United coach Erik ten Hag despite their shaky start to the season.
The Red Devils have started their league campaign with two wins, two losses and a draw in their opening five league encounters, which included a 3-0 loss to Liverpool.

Despite the criticism in recent months, Tottenham Hotspur's Ange Postecoglou says the Dutch tactician is doing a good job at Old Trafford.
"I think Erik's in a really tough job and he's done really well." the coach said, as per Goal.
"He keeps mentioning he's won two trophies and that's not insignificant, everyone keeps telling me that's all I have to do, but it's not all you have to do, because when you do that there's always more.
"He's done a great job, a difficult job."
The North London outfit will make the trip to Old Trafford on Sunday afternoon to face Ten Hag and the Red Devils.
